Marianne’s Swing and Stride for Hope Raises an Incredible £108,750 for Evora Hospice
Pictured are James and Marianne Tiernan with their daughters, Teghan and Sarah, presenting a cheque for the outstanding sum of £108,750 to Siobhan McArdle, Evora Hospice.
The same amount was also donated to Pretty in Pink, bringing the total raised by the event to a phenomenal £217,500.
The entire community came together to support this remarkable fundraising effort. While there are far too many people to mention individually, Marianne was keen to express her heartfelt gratitude to everyone who contributed, volunteered, sponsored, attended, or supported the event in any way.
